ATP 250 Men’s Professional Tournament begins at Barnes Tennis Center.
SAN DIEGO – Seventh-seeded James Duckworth defeated fellow Australian Alexei Popyrin in three sets while Tomas Martin Etcheverry defeated fellow Argentine Facundo Mena in straight sets as first-round singles play began Monday in the second annual $612,000 San Diego Open ATP 250 men’s tournament at Barnes Tennis Center.
Duckworth dropped 13 spots to 83rd on the Association of Tennis Professionals singles rankings released Monday. Popyrin was ranked 90th for the second consecutive week.
